- WHAT EXPRESSIONS DO I NEED TO KNOW TO UNDERSTAND THIS DOCUMENT?
For the purposes of this document and in accordance with the General Personal Data Protection Law (“LGPD” – Law No. 13.709/2018) and related legislation, such as the Marco Civil da Internet (MCI – Law 12.965/2014) and the Defense Code (CDC – Law no. 8.078/1990), you, the Holder, must interpret the following terms as follows:
a) PERSONAL DATA(S): information(s) relating to an identified or identifiable natural person;
b) CONTROLLER: natural or legal person, governed by public or private law, who is responsible for decisions regarding the processing of personal data;
c) HOLDER(S): natural person(s) to whom the personal data subject to processing refers;
d) NATIONAL AUTHORITY: ANPD (National Data Protection Authority), a public administration body responsible for ensuring, implementing and monitoring compliance with the LGPD throughout the national territory;
e) OPERATOR: natural or legal person, governed by public or private law, who processes personal data on behalf of the controller;
f) ANONYMIZED DATA: data relating to the Holder that cannot be identified, considering the use of reasonable technical means available at the time of its processing;
g) ANONYMIZATION: use of reasonable technical means available at the time of processing, through which data loses the possibility of association, directly or indirectly, with an individual;
h) PROCESSING: any operation carried out with personal data, such as those relating to collection, production, reception, classification, use, access, reproduction, transmission, distribution, processing, archiving, storage, elimination, evaluation or control of information, modification , communication, transfer, diffusion or extraction;
i) BLOCKING: temporary suspension of any processing operation, by storing personal data or the database;
j) ELIMINATION: deletion of data or set of data stored in a database, regardless of the procedure used.

- WHAT ARE MY RIGHTS?
Pursuant to article 18 of the LGPD, the Holder has the right to obtain, in relation to the data processed, at any time and upon request, the following:
a) Confirmation and access: receive information about confirmation of the existence of processing of your personal data, which personal data is processed and with whom it is shared, and may also request access to personal data being processed by Rotary-Ax;
b) Correction: request the correction of personal data that is incomplete, inaccurate or out of date;
c) Revocation of consent: in cases of processing of personal data based exclusively on consent, express the revocation of this authorization at any time, through an accessible and free channel, so that the data is deleted;
d) Anonymization, blocking or deletion: request anonymization, blocking or deletion when personal data is unnecessary, excessive or treated in non-compliance with the provisions of the LGPD or this Policy;
e) Portability: request the transfer of data to another service or product provider, upon express request and observing commercial and industrial secrets, in accordance with legal regulations and with the exception of data that has already been anonymized by Rotary-Ax;
f) Sharing: request information about the public and private entities with which Rotary-Ax shared the Holder’s personal data;
g) Non-consent: be informed about the possibility of not providing consent and the consequences of refusal;
